ARTiculate: Creative Workshops for Every Stage

That's a wrap for ARTiculate in 2026.

Thank you to everyone who joined us and contributed to such an inspiring and welcoming creative community.

Designed to support creatives at every stage, the series provided opportunities to connect, learn, share ideas and build confidence through practical and engaging sessions. Whether you were taking your first creative steps or expanding an established practice, we hope each workshop helped spark new ideas and connections.

As we look ahead to 2027, we're excited to continue creating opportunities for artists, makers and visionaries to learn, collaborate and grow. In the meantime, we'd love your input.

Tell us below what types of workshops, programs or creative experiences you'd like to see in the future. Your ideas will help shape the next chapter of our creative program.
